DESCRIPTION

Accenture’s Security Practice is one of the fastest growing areas of the business with significant growth plans through additional recruitment and acquisitions.

As part of our global team, you'll be working with cutting-edge technologies and will have the opportunity to develop a wide range of new skills on the job. You'll work on innovative projects with colleagues to drive collaboration from strategy through to implementation. You will be using the latest technologies with clients to help them get to the next level. You will provide information security domain expertise and utilise your eye for business to work multi-functionally with our clients to advise, design, build and implement pragmatic security solutions.

 

TYPICAL ROLES INCLUDE ASPECTS OF THE FOLLOWING:

-  Information Security, Risk and Assessment

-  Security Audit and Maturity Assessment

-  Assessment of security requirements to meet control objectives and risk appetite

-  Review of solutions to assess security compliance

-  Working in teams to deliver security change in complex organisations

-  Work in interesting environments including large Enterprise, Cloud and IOT

-  Contributing to business development

 


Qualifications - External

SKILLS AND EXPERIENCE

You will have some or all of the following skills and experiences:

 

-  Experience working in a regulated environment

-  Security Audit and Assessment

-  Infrastructure and Network Security

-  Security Architecture

-  Application Security Testing

-  4+ years of relevant experience

-  Project management and delivery experience

-  Security qualifications such as SSCP, CCSP, CISSP, CISM, CISA, ISO 27001, PCI DSS

-  3rd level qualification
